About 3-methoxy-5-pyrazol-1-ylphenol
3-methoxy-5-pyrazol-1-ylphenol (PubChem CID 165141321) has the molecular formula C10H10N2O2
and a molecular weight of 190.20 g/mol. Its IUPAC name is 3-methoxy-5-pyrazol-1-ylphenol.
